Submission #60285404
Source Code Expand
#include<bits/stdc++.h> #include"atcoder/all" using namespace std; using namespace atcoder; #define rep(i,n) for(int i=0;i<(n);i++) #define all(a) a.begin(),a.end() typedef long long ll; typedef vector<ll> vi; typedef pair<ll,ll> P; const ll mod=1000000007; const ll inf=1ll<<61; typedef modint1000000007 mi; int main(){ ll n;cin>>n; int factor=0; for(ll i=2;i*i<=n;i++){ while(n%i==0){ n/=i; factor++; } } if(n>1)factor++; int ans=0; while(factor>(1<<ans))ans++; cout<<ans<<endl; }
Submission Info
Submission Time | |
---|---|
Task | 075 - Magic For Balls(★3) |
User | Rho17 |
Language | C++ 20 (gcc 12.2) |
Score | 3 |
Code Size | 531 Byte |
Status | AC |
Exec Time | 4 ms |
Memory | 3692 KiB |
Judge Result
Set Name | Sample | All | ||||
---|---|---|---|---|---|---|
Score / Max Score | 0 / 0 | 3 / 3 | ||||
Status |
|
|
Set Name | Test Cases |
---|---|
Sample | sample_01.txt, sample_02.txt, sample_03.txt, sample_04.txt |
All | hand_01.txt, hand_02.txt, large_factors_01.txt, large_factors_02.txt, large_factors_03.txt, large_factors_04.txt, large_factors_05.txt, many_01.txt, many_02.txt, many_03.txt, many_04.txt, many_06.txt, many_07.txt, many_08.txt, prime_01.txt, prime_02.txt, prime_03.txt, prime_04.txt, prime_05.txt, random_01.txt, random_02.txt, random_03.txt, random_04.txt, random_05.txt, random_06.txt, random_07.txt, random_08.txt, random_09.txt, random_10.txt, sample_01.txt, sample_02.txt, sample_03.txt, sample_04.txt, special_01.txt, special_02.txt, special_03.txt |
Case Name | Status | Exec Time | Memory |
---|---|---|---|
hand_01.txt | AC | 1 ms | 3504 KiB |
hand_02.txt | AC | 1 ms | 3500 KiB |
large_factors_01.txt | AC | 2 ms | 3500 KiB |
large_factors_02.txt | AC | 2 ms | 3476 KiB |
large_factors_03.txt | AC | 2 ms | 3504 KiB |
large_factors_04.txt | AC | 2 ms | 3536 KiB |
large_factors_05.txt | AC | 2 ms | 3496 KiB |
many_01.txt | AC | 1 ms | 3496 KiB |
many_02.txt | AC | 1 ms | 3516 KiB |
many_03.txt | AC | 1 ms | 3516 KiB |
many_04.txt | AC | 1 ms | 3536 KiB |
many_06.txt | AC | 1 ms | 3536 KiB |
many_07.txt | AC | 1 ms | 3576 KiB |
many_08.txt | AC | 1 ms | 3504 KiB |
prime_01.txt | AC | 3 ms | 3532 KiB |
prime_02.txt | AC | 3 ms | 3692 KiB |
prime_03.txt | AC | 2 ms | 3536 KiB |
prime_04.txt | AC | 3 ms | 3448 KiB |
prime_05.txt | AC | 1 ms | 3688 KiB |
random_01.txt | AC | 1 ms | 3668 KiB |
random_02.txt | AC | 1 ms | 3520 KiB |
random_03.txt | AC | 2 ms | 3500 KiB |
random_04.txt | AC | 1 ms | 3536 KiB |
random_05.txt | AC | 1 ms | 3520 KiB |
random_06.txt | AC | 1 ms | 3540 KiB |
random_07.txt | AC | 1 ms | 3516 KiB |
random_08.txt | AC | 2 ms | 3544 KiB |
random_09.txt | AC | 1 ms | 3504 KiB |
random_10.txt | AC | 1 ms | 3684 KiB |
sample_01.txt | AC | 1 ms | 3540 KiB |
sample_02.txt | AC | 2 ms | 3516 KiB |
sample_03.txt | AC | 1 ms | 3500 KiB |
sample_04.txt | AC | 1 ms | 3480 KiB |
special_01.txt | AC | 4 ms | 3540 KiB |
special_02.txt | AC | 4 ms | 3600 KiB |
special_03.txt | AC | 4 ms | 3688 KiB |